在数字时代的浪潮下,网站开发早已成为各行各业的必备技能。无论你是网站开发的新手,还是经验丰富的老手,这里提供的实用知识和深入教程都将助你打造高性能、安全稳定的优质网站。让我们开始这场关于网站技术的深度探索之旅。
假设我们面临着一个情境:一个新兴的电商平台想要进行全面升级,以便应对日益增长的用户量和交易数据,同时还要保障网站的高性能、稳定性和安全性。这样的升级任务便是对网站开发技术的全方位挑战。
在电商平台的升级过程中,数据库管理扮演着至关重要的角色。面对日益增长的用户信息和交易数据,我们需要一个强大的数据库系统来支撑。传统的关系型数据库如MySQL和Oracle虽然强大,但在处理海量数据时可能会遇到瓶颈。因此,引入NoSQL数据库如MongoDB和Cassandra是一个明智的选择,它们能灵活处理大规模数据并保证高性能运行。在架构设计中,读写分离、分库分表等策略能有效提高数据库的处理能力。通过缓存系统如Redis和Memcached的使用,可以进一步提高数据读取效率并缓解数据库压力。但是如何保证这么多技术的融合以及整体系统稳定运行就需要我们的服务器运维出马了。四、服务器运维:确保稳定运行的关键为了保证网站的稳定运行和安全可靠的数据管理,有效的服务器管理和维护是必要的步骤建立一个稳定的运维系统能有效解决潜在的威胁包括防火墙安全、网络安全等问题在实施方面部署安全策略和自动化运维流程非常关键服务器日志管理和数据分析也有助于实时监控和诊断潜在的问题保持高效的监控流程以确保出现问题时能迅速响应例如当出现恶意流量攻击时能够及时检测到并实施相应措施从而保证系统的正常运行五、代码优化:提升网站性能的关键环节代码优化是提升网站性能的关键环节在这个过程中我们需要对代码进行详细的审查找出潜在的性能瓶颈和安全问题借助代码分析工具可以帮助我们更高效地识别和解决这些问题例如我们可以使用静态代码分析工具来检查代码质量找出潜在的错误和漏洞使用性能分析工具来监控代码运行时的性能情况分析潜在的瓶颈找到优化的方向使用持续集成与持续部署的流程能够帮助我们在每次代码提交时自动进行代码检查并执行自动化测试确保代码质量和性能不断优化六、结尾:构建优质网站的全面指南通过综合运用前沿建站技术代码优化数据库管理服务器运维等技术我们可以打造一个高性能安全稳定的优质网站在这个过程中我们不仅要掌握扎实的专业知识还需要具备丰富的实战经验不断探索和学习新技术以应对不断变化的挑战通过这次深度探索之旅我们相信你对网站开发有了更深入的了解并掌握了构建优质网站的全面指南无论你是新手还是老手都可以在这里找到适合自己的教程和技巧让我们一起继续探索网站技术的无限可能世界七、展望未来:新技术引领网站开发新潮流随着科技的不断发展新技术不断涌现未来的网站开发将呈现出更多新的特点和趋势例如人工智能和机器学习将在网站开发中发挥更大的作用实现更智能的用户体验和个性化的服务前端技术也将继续发展出现更多新的框架和技术提高开发效率和用户体验云计算和边缘计算等技术将继续推动网站架构的优化提高性能和稳定性同时安全性和隐私保护将成为网站开发的重要考虑因素总结起来未来的网站开发将是一个充满机遇和挑战的领域我们需要不断学习新技术保持敏锐的洞察力紧跟时代步伐打造更优质更智能更安全的网站结语希望你在这次网站技术的深度探索之旅中收获满满的知识和技能不断提升自己在网站开发领域的竞争力让我们一起迎接未来的挑战共同创造更美好的数字世界我们始终相信每一次的技术探索都将推动我们前进的步伐不断向前迈向更高的峰顶杂货库永远为你开放欢迎你的每一次探索与学习让我们一起创造无限可能的世界!